From an economic and strategic perspective, the Strait of Malacca is one of the most important shipping lanes in the world. The strait is the main shipping channel between the Indian Ocean and the Pacific Ocean, linking major Asian economies such as India, China, Japan, Taiwan, and South Korea.

Singapore controls the smallest area of the strait, but the city-state enjoys the biggest economic benefit from shipping activities.
